Nginx部署angular项目
下载Nginx。具体可查看我之前写过的nginx安装方法https://blog.****.net/chending_cd/article/details/100557233
在确认nginx配置成功的情况下。即你输入ip可看到
这个是重点。
angular部署很简单。
angular项目打包
ng build
打包完成会在根目录生成一个dist文件。例如我打包好了我的angular项目。
进去centos系统 在nginx/html 下放人 dist内打包好的文件。
修改nginx的conf配置文件
首先配置访问项目地址在html下ess-web文件夹也就是dist生成出来的前端静态资源
try_files $uri $uri/ /index.html; // 注意此句,一定要加上。否则配置的子路由等无法使用
重启nginx服务。
————————————————